Hellas Verona are close to securing Club Brugge and Morocco midfielder Sofyan Amrabat, on loan with option to buy for €3m.

Both La Gazzetta dello Sport and Sportitalia have the same story, noting the 23-year-old talent is on his way to Serie A.

It is expected to be a loan deal with option to buy for a total sum of €3m, although it remains to be seen how that will be spread out.

Despite turning 23 this week, Amrabat already has eight senior caps for Morocco under his belt.

He was born in the Netherlands, featuring for Utrecht and Feyenoord before his €2.5m move to Club Brugge last summer.

The midfielder scored one goal in 29 competitive games for the Belgians last term and had also been linked with Bologna.
